Tom Elmhirst gives us a behind the scenes look at drum and vocal elements from Adele's smash hit 'Rolling in the Deep'
Filmed at Electric Lady studios in NYC, this exclusive series uncovers the magic behind the sound of Adele’s 2010 superhit ‘Rolling in the Deep’. With the Pro Tools multi-track session spread across a Neve VR console, the famed mixer Tom Elmhirst takes you through his analog signal chains and routing. Following an overview of his inserts, effects sends, busses, and mix chain, he comments on Paul Epworth’s rough mix and then starts a new mix himself. Within about twenty minutes, he feels that his new mix is sonically superior to his original version! Tom demonstrates his usage of VCA faders, parallel drum treatment, console EQ, vocal effects, automation, de-essing, and other techniques acquired throughout his illustrious career.
